Establish and manage complex colonies with players and NPCs in Minecraft Bedrock. This addon equips you with a set of tools to maintain a large, autonomous settlement where NPCs are assigned to specialized roles.

Founding a Colony
Founding Your First Colony
To begin, place a Fence Pole, craft a Flag, and place it on top of the pole. This triggers the founding process, allowing you to choose a name, flag colors, and your Government Type.
- Note: Choosing a “Democratic” rule allows the colony to hold elections for the position of Mayor.
Once established, the colony will register its territory, making the surrounding area available for blueprint construction.

The Mayor’s Table
The Mayor’s Table is your central management hub. Here, you can assign ranks to players or hire NPCs for 10 Emeralds each.


Assigning NPC Jobs
After hiring an NPC, tap on them to assign a job. It is highly recommended to assign your first two NPCs as Builders, as they are required for construction.
NPCs can be assigned roles such as Farmers, Potion Makers, Miners, Hunters, or Knights. As they work, they will yield resources that you can collect by interacting with them.

Knights: These are essential for defense. You will need Iron Ingots to promote an NPC to a Knight to protect the settlement from raids.

Feed Your Workers
Place Food Baskets around the village and keep them stocked. Workers will not work without food and may eventually abandon the colony if they are neglected.

Blueprint Construction
Use the Blueprint Workbench to access building plans. When you select a house blueprint and place it, a preview will appear along with UI controls (arrows) to adjust its orientation and position. To begin the actual build, you must have at least two NPCs assigned to the Builder role.
